Alliance launches new toolkit to support transition from the early years to school

by Jess Gibson

The Early Years Alliance has launched a new toolkit to support early years settings when preparing children for the transition from early years education to school. 

The Transitions Toolkit - Moving on up aims to ensure that early years providers feel confident in their ability to make children feel safe, heard, understood, and their emotional wellbeing supported during this process, and to support both providers and families to reflect on the transition process for children starting school. 

The toolkit includes a range of practical resources and supporting resources that can help to promote positive transitions, taking into consideration the equally important roles that families, early years providers, schools and the community play. It is designed to ensure that the child remains at the centre of the process and is offered the best support for a smooth process.

In addition to the toolkit, the Alliance runs free sessions entitled Moving on up – supporting families to transition to school. These sessions are for early educators and provide resources, alongside support, to deliver a three-week family learning programme to families in their setting.
